The version in Scott Howard's repository is working for me. Thanks!!! ...But minor issue is that some of the graphics backends don't work. (Under Tools --> Preferences --> IPython console or Python console).
For IPython console, the default (inline) works fine, and Qt4 also works fine, but Qt5 doesn't work: In [1]: import matplotlib.pyplot as plt In [2]: plt.plot(3,3) Traceback (most recent call last): File "<ipython-input-2-4e78340ee40a>", line 1, in <module> plt.plot(3,3) File "/usr/lib/python3/dist-packages/matplotlib/pyplot.py", line 3146, in plot ax = gca() File "/usr/lib/python3/dist-packages/matplotlib/pyplot.py", line 928, in gca return gcf().gca(**kwargs) File "/usr/lib/python3/dist-packages/matplotlib/pyplot.py", line 578, in gcf return figure() File "/usr/lib/python3/dist-packages/matplotlib/pyplot.py", line 527, in figure **kwargs) File "/usr/lib/python3/dist-packages/matplotlib/backends/backend_qt5agg.py", line 43, in new_figure_manager return new_figure_manager_given_figure(num, thisFig) File "/usr/lib/python3/dist-packages/matplotlib/backends/backend_qt5agg.py", line 51, in new_figure_manager_given_figure return FigureManagerQT(canvas, num) File "/usr/lib/python3/dist-packages/matplotlib/backends/backend_qt5.py", line 465, in __init__ self.toolbar.message.connect(self._show_message) TypeError: connect() failed between NavigationToolbar2QT.message[str] and _show_message() For Python console, the default ("automatic") doesn't work (similar error) but one of the other options (Tkinter) works.
